Novato's Climate Profile

Novato enjoys more sun hours than much of coastal Marin — a drier, warmer microclimate buffered from the coast by the Marin hills. This benefits court play, but also means thermal expansion cycles must be accounted for in surface joint planning and acrylic application thickness.

🌍

Soil & Subsurface Conditions

Much of the Novato basin sits atop clay-dominant soils — expansive, moisture-sensitive material that shifts seasonally with Marin's wet-dry cycle. Proper subgrade preparation, compaction, and aggregate layering are non-negotiable on these lots. We engineer to address this directly.

Topography & Elevation Variation

From the flatter parcels near downtown Novato to the hillside properties above Pacheco Valle and into the Indian Valley corridor, elevation and slope vary considerably. Site-specific grading plans are essential — and standard-issue designs simply do not translate.

💨

Wind Exposure & Orientation

Afternoon northerly winds are a fixture in Novato's warmer months. We consider prevailing wind direction when advising on court orientation, which directly affects play quality and surface wear patterns over time. Proper alignment turns this natural element from a nuisance into a non-factor.

☀️

Sun Positioning & Glare

Novato's extended afternoon sun — particularly during summer months — makes east-west court orientation a careful consideration. The classic north-south alignment typically serves Novato conditions well, and we evaluate sun angle relative to each parcel's specific geometry.

Acrylic Hard Court Systems

The most widely deployed tennis surface in California, acrylic systems deliver a consistent, low-maintenance playing experience. Multiple texture grades affect ball speed and player comfort. Applied in multiple coats over a prepared asphalt or concrete base, they are engineered to respond well to Novato's thermal range.

Cushioned Court Systems

Cushioned acrylic systems incorporate a rubberized underlayer that meaningfully reduces impact on joints during extended play. An ideal solution for residential courts serving a broad age range, or for facilities focused on player longevity and comfort without sacrificing surface consistency.

A regulation singles court requires 78 × 36 feet, but the full construction footprint — including run-off space behind baselines and along sidelines — typically demands a minimum of 120 × 60 feet. For hillside or irregularly shaped Novato parcels, we conduct a detailed site evaluation to determine usable area, required grading, and whether the topography supports a full-size or modified court layout. Do not estimate this from a site plan alone — an on-site assessment is the only reliable starting point.

How Saviano Co. Builds a Court in Novato — Step by Step

A well-constructed tennis court is the product of a disciplined sequence — not a compressed timeline. Here is how Saviano Co. approaches every project in the Novato area, from initial site visit through final walkthrough.

01

Site Evaluation & Soil Assessment

We begin on your property — not at a desk. Our team evaluates grade, drainage patterns, soil composition, sun exposure, wind direction, and access constraints. In Novato, this step is critical given the variability in soil type and topography across different neighborhoods and parcel orientations.

02

Design, Layout & Engineering Plans

Following site assessment, we develop a detailed court design that accounts for your parcel's specific conditions. This includes drainage engineering, grade calculations, court orientation relative to sun and wind, and any lighting or fencing integration. You review and approve before any ground is broken.

03

Excavation & Subgrade Preparation

Excavation depth and compaction specifications are calibrated to Novato's clay-bearing soils. This phase includes any necessary grading to achieve precise court slope — typically a 1% cross-slope gradient — for effective surface drainage. The quality of this phase determines the long-term performance of everything above it.

04

Aggregate Base & Drainage Systems

Properly specified crushed aggregate is installed and compacted in controlled lifts. Drainage infrastructure — collection channels, perimeter drains, or subsurface systems — is installed in this phase. In Novato's wet season conditions, drainage engineering is not an afterthought — it is foundational.

05

Base Surface Installation

Asphalt or concrete base is laid according to the engineering specification. Mix design, thickness, and joint placement are selected for Novato's thermal environment. Adequate cure time is observed before proceeding — compressing this phase is how courts develop problems down the line.

06

Acrylic Surface Application & Color Coating

Acrylic resurfacer and color coats are applied in precise layers, with adequate dry time between coats. Application thickness, texture, and color selection are executed according to the client's design preferences and the site's specific sun exposure characteristics. Cushioned underlayers, where specified, are installed in advance of color application.

07

Line Striping & Net Post Installation

After the surface achieves full cure, precision line striping is executed with exacting dimensional accuracy. Net post anchors and any lighting foundations are set during this phase. Fencing, if included in the project scope, is installed to complete the perimeter.
